The illness is characterized by prolonged fever, evidence of inflammation in the body and involvement of one or more organ systems, and is now being called “Multisystem Inflammatory Syndrome in Children (MIS-C).” Some children have experienced inflammation of the heart, vomiting, diarrhea, abdominal pain, kidney injury and/or rash.

The clinical presentation has varied but includes fever and a constellation of symptoms including shock, multi-organ involvement and elevated inflammatory markers. Some cases have had features of typical or atypical Kawasaki disease and/or features of toxic shock syndrome. Features of Multi-system Inflammatory Syndrome in Children (MIS-C)

Multi-Organ Dysfunction Syndrome (MSOF) The patient has an initial injury. This either causes a direct cascade of sequential injuries or causes massive release of inflammatory cytokines, which causes collateral damage. The result is widespread microvascular injury, organ dysfunction, and failure. Goal is to prevent this. Pitfalls of the ICU
